How they compare

South America currently reports 4.07 kt against 0.4832 kt in South Africa, a difference of 3.59 kt.

That makes South America's figure about 8.4 times South Africa's.

Across all 65 years both countries report, South America has been ahead every year.

South Africa ranks 11th and South America ranks 11th of 164 countries.

South America has averaged higher in every one of the 9 decades both report.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
